Get in Touch** The Honda repair market serving Almyra, Arkansas, is characterized by its reliance on the nearby city of Stuttgart. As a small, rural community, Almyra itself lacks specialized automotive service centers. The market in Stuttgart is moderately competitive, consisting of a mix of long-standing general repair shops and one standout specialist (Import Specialists). The average quality of Honda service is good for standard repairs and maintenance, but for advanced, brand-specific issues (like hybrid system service, SH-AWD, or performance tuning), residents would likely need to travel to larger cities like Little Rock (approx. 60 miles away). Pricing is generally reasonable and below national chain averages, reflecting the local cost of living. Labor rates are typically competitive, but the depth of specialized Honda expertise is the primary differentiator between the available providers.

Common questions about honda repair services in Almyra, AR
Given Almyra's small size, you'll likely need to look to nearby cities like Stuttgart or DeWitt for specialized Honda service. Seek shops that are ASE-certified and have strong local reputations; asking neighbors for recommendations is very effective in our close-knit community.
Due to our rural roads and agricultural surroundings, Honda owners commonly face suspension wear from uneven terrain and issues with air filters/clogged intakes from dusty conditions. Older Honda models may also need attention for CV joint and axle wear from frequent driving on gravel roads.
You should seek immediate service for dashboard warning lights (like the check engine light), unusual noises from the brakes or suspension on our country roads, or overheating, especially during hot Arkansas summers. Prompt attention prevents minor issues from becoming major breakdowns far from service centers.
Labor rates in the Almyra area can be competitive, but parts may take longer to source, potentially affecting turnaround time. It's wise to get a written estimate that details both parts and labor, as some shops may need to order specific Honda components from distributors further away.
Consider the shop's proximity for convenience and their familiarity with wear from local driving conditions like dirt roads and high humidity. Planning ahead for service is crucial, as some specialized appointments may require scheduling around peak agricultural seasons when local shops are busiest.
